- adjectiveinhospitable (adjective)
- (of an environment) harsh and difficult to live in:"the inhospitable landscape"
- (of a person) unfriendly and unwelcoming toward people.
Originlate 16th century: French, from in- ‘not’ + hospitable (see hospitable).Similar and Opposite Wordsadjective
